Output 6e13c292504818ca7e73a576dd30d44d75a007c510205d97bd1c0fb65161d66d:0

value
1038880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5dcf91f90e9588146af885f0e2927ec5a8359de OP_EQUAL
address
3Q72C2QL8tuACpKb5FHJkKSfULmbpbGNrA
transaction
6e13c292504818ca7e73a576dd30d44d75a007c510205d97bd1c0fb65161d66d
spent
true